The reasons for this PR are still in place. We handle timezones not really correctly and therefore get flaky tests shortly before and after the dates for winter/summertime adjustments. We have two ways of handling this. First, we could try to correct the way we handle timezones in the JMeter function. (I didn't get far with that and gave up). Second, we could handle the time offset in the test case, making sure, that it doesn't fail in that short period before and after the date of time adjustment (which is, what has been done in this PR, but Vladimir seems to dislike it and I don't want to merge stuff, that he dislikes). ----------------------------------------------------------------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
